Manchester United are expected to be active in the summer transfer window and one name they are being heavily linked with is that of Eberechi Eze. The Crystal Palace star has enjoyed a solid season and has attracted interest from several Premier League sides.

As the Man Utd transfer news reported by Spanish outlet Fichajes, Ruben Amorim has specifically asked the Manchester United board to do everything in their power to sign Eze. The Portuguese manager considers the English international to be a key piece in his long-term plans at Old Trafford.

Eze has the kind of skillset that Amorim wants in his new-look Manchester United attack and is viewed as someone who could make an immediate impact.

The 26-year-old has made over 160 appearances for Crystal Palace since joining them from Queens Park Rangers in 2020. He has contributed with 33 goals and 28 assists during that time and has also earned 10 caps for the England national team, scoring once.

Eze is comfortable playing as an attacking midfielder or out wide, which makes him an ideal fit in different systems. That kind of versatility could be a huge bonus for Amorim, who is expected to make significant changes to United's frontline this summer.

Of course, signing him won’t be easy. Not only will Manchester United have to negotiate a deal with Crystal Palace, but they also face stiff competition from the likes of Liverpool, Arsenal, Tottenham Hotspur and Aston Villa.

The Villans, interestingly, could enter the race for Eze if they fail to make Marcus Rashford’s loan deal permanent.

Manchester United have lacked spark in the final third for much of the campaign. Bringing in someone like Eze could help change that dynamic and add creativity to the side.

Now, it remains to be seen if the Red Devils are able to strike a deal for one of the most exciting English players in the Premier League today.
